Exhibition Celebrates Grand Ethiopian Renaissance Dam's 14-Year Journey

Sep 13, 2025

An exhibition chronicling the 14-year journey of the Grand Ethiopian Renaissance Dam (GERD) has opened at the Adwa Victory Memorial in Addis Ababa. The event, held under the theme "Ethiopia Can," showcases a collection of photos and paintings that document the dam's construction from start to finish.

Organized by the Addis Ababa City Administration, the exhibition was launched to mark the near-completion of the GERD and is now open to the public.

The opening ceremony drew a number of high-profile government officials. Among those in attendance Attending the event were several high-profile officials, including Jantirar Abay, Deputy Mayor of the Addis Ababa City Administration, Moges Balcha, Head of the Addis Ababa Prosperity Party Branch Office, and Aregawi Berhe, Chief Executive of the GERD Public Coordination Office.

The exhibition is intended to celebrate the dam as a symbol of national resilience and engineering achievement.
